A Multi-Agent Framework for Supporting Intelligent Fourth-Party Logistics
description A distributed intelligent agent-based framework that supports fourth-party logistics optimization under a web-based e-Commerce environment has been proposed in this paper. In the framework, customer job requests come through an e-Procurement service. These requests are consolidated and pushed to the e-Market Place service periodically. The e-Market Place then serves as a broker that allows intelligent agents to bid to serve these requests optimally in real-time by solving multiple instances of underlying logistics optimization problem. The resulting system was implemented based on the Java 2 Enterprise Edition (J2EE) platform using distributed system technology for communication between objects.
